LIC is a farmer-owned co-operative that’s been supporting herd improvement in New Zealand’s dairy sector for more than 115 years. We’re focused on providing superior genetics, reliable testing and diagnostics, integrated on-farm software, and great customer service, all designed to help farmers make smarter decisions every day.

About the Role:
Reporting to the Business Solutions Manager, you will be part of a team which supports core business functions for LIC. Specifically, this role will be focused on the operational running, maintenance and changes to our core business software solutions which cover finance, sales, logistics, HR, payroll, CRM and associated business functions.
You will help liaise between third-party vendors around system changes and BAU support and will help inform the priority of work to be done on behalf of the business units involved.
Currently many of these business functions are delivered through SAP solutions, but there is a momentum to move this functionality into Salesforce and S/4 HANA centric cloud-based solutions as part of a multi-year technology transformation program. This will re-shape how our Technology services are delivered and supported, meaning the exact responsibilities of the System Analyst will morph over time to adapt to these ever-changing needs in a modern organisation.
